比如我有
<p id="test">测试</p>
<p id="test1">测试1</p>
<p id="test2">测试2</p>
<p id="test3">测试3</p>
. test4
. test 5
. test6......
请问一下我想让隐藏除了id 为test 和test1的元素. 该怎么写.
第一个测试,标签是p id 为test
第二个测试1,标签是p id为test1
以下类推
<!DOCTYPE html>
<html>
<head>
<script type="text/javascript" src="http://www.w3school.com.cn/jquery/jquery.js"></script>
</head>
<body>
<ul>
<li id="li1">list item 1</li>
<li>list item 2</li>
<li id="li3">list item 3</li>
<li>list item 4</li>
<li>list item 5</li>
</ul>
<script>
$('li').not('#li1,#li3').hide();
</script>
</body>
</html>
<!DOCTYPE html>
测试
测试1
测试2
测试3
测试4
测试5
测试6
//$('p').not('#test,#test1').hide(); $("p:not('#test,#test1')").hide();